Taking inspiration from DevTogether, we're hosting a matched pairing night!
Folks can sign up to either be a "Learner" or a "Helper", specifying which areas (ie: resume review, product management, Ruby on Rails) that they're interested in either working on or helping someone with, respectively, and we'll match people based on their skillsets / interests!

SCHEDULE
Starting around 7:10pm, we'll do introductions and assign folks to breakout rooms. The next hour will be spent working on the "Learners'" goals, tasks or projects.
Around 8:15pm, we'll come back together in the main room, and anyone who'd like can share what they worked on and learned!
